Beers to this position.The creation of this new staff position results primarily from the necessity of assuring effective coordination of National Military Establishment activities which are closely related to civil defense with the activities of those civilian government agencies which have been made responsible for civil defense planning as such. The ultimate objective is to make certain that planning and preparations for civil defense are properly related to planning and preparations for military defense and that each complements the other.Colonel Beers had been executive assistant in the National Military Establishment Office of Civil Defense Planning since it was first established, on March 27, 1948.
